Depending on what you are doing with the ladder, it should be pretty obvious how to extend and retract it, but nothing about how to retract it is clearly stated. To release each section, you have to push two buttons at the same time. You can get your fingers pinched, so it is to protect them, but it is very Each section slams down as it retracts. It appears the retract process takes two steps per section. In the past, I have seen other ladders with sequential retractable sections, which have damping features to prevent them from slamming into one another. to be my preferred option, but it will take some time for me to determine how well I like.
